Husband of Woman Found Dead in Condo Stairwell Last Fall Arrested on Domestic Violence Charges

The husband of a woman found dead at the foot of a stairwell in his Chicago condominium building last fall has been arrested on.a warrant from Michigan.

Court documents say Adam Beckerink, 46, was arrested Friday at the same building where Caitlin Tracey’s body was found on October 27, WGN reported.

Authorities said he was arrested on domestic violence charges filed in Berrien County, Michigan, where Tracey lived before and during her marriage, but no other information was released.

According to WBBM, the warrant was issued in Michigan on October 31, four days before Tracey’s body was found. It’s unclear why he wasn’t arrested until now.

Beckerink had reported Tracey missing on October 26. Another tenant found Tracey’s severed foot in the stairwell the next day, and police found her body at the bottom of the stairs. A cause of death has not been determined.

Beckerink was held for questioning for two days, but no charges were filed.

Tracey had filed for an order of protection against Beckerink a year before her death, citing several incidents in which she accused him of abuse. She withdrew the petition after Beckerink threatened to sue her, court records show.

Twice in 2024, Beckerink was arrested in New Buffalo, Michigan, on domestic violence charges.

Beckerink and Tracey’s parents argued over her remains for two weeks after her death before a Michigan judge gave the parents custody for a funeral and burial.
